A well-mannered table sets the tone for everything else. Simple courtesies — arriving on time, handling chips neatly, avoiding table talk during hands, and congratulating winners — make the game more pleasant for all. Newcomers are welcome, provided they are open to learning and willing to keep the environment relaxed and respectful.
